This was the ultimate comfort food. My sister and I made this together and weren't sure how it would turn out but all of the flavors ended up coming together beautifully. Some things we did a little different were using large shell pasta instead of macaroni which hold more of the sauce in the pasta. We also used half milk and half heavy cream, used a can of chopped green chilies, and topped the dish off with some shredded cheese the last few minutes of baking. It turned out perfect and very delicious... I definitely recommend trying this recipe!

This was a great recipe. I made it for a get together we had yesterday and everyone came back for more. Even our 5-year-old liked it so much he ate it twice yesterday. I had to add 1 more cup of milk than the recipe calls for, hence, 4 stars instead of 5 or would have been perfect. For those who don't like it spicy or hot, I would reduce the amount of chipotle chiles to 1 or 2. But it added a little kick that a typical mac & cheese recipe doesn't have and made it GREAT!

This was really good - I did change it a little bit because the amount of milk made it look like it would be too dry. I put in 4 cups of milk. I only put in 2 chilis because while they're pretty good about strong flavors, it would have been a little too spicy for them. I thought 2 was a good amount.
